About FMCG Industry

India's fourth-largest household and personal care segment are the fast-moving consumer
goods (FMCG) sector, accounting for 50 percent of FMCG sales in India. The main growth
drivers for the sector have been increasing awareness, easier access and changing lifestyles.
The urban segment (approximately 55 percent revenue share) is the largest contributor to
India's overall revenue generated by the FMCG sector. In the last few years, however, the
FMCG market in rural India has risen faster compared to urban India. The semi-urban and rural
segments are rising rapidly, with FMCG goods accounting for 50% of total rural expenditure.
India's retail market is projected to reach US$ 1.1 trillion by 2020, up from US$ 840 billion in
2017, with modern trade anticipated to rise by 20% to 25% annually, which is likely to raise
FMCG companies' revenue. In FY18, FMCG industry revenue reached Rs. 3.4 lakh crore (US$
52.75 billion) and is expected to reach US$ 103.7 billion in 2020. In 2020, the FMCG market was
projected to rise by 9-10 percent.

About Dabur India Ltd.


Dabur India Ltd. is one of India's leading FMCG companies with a revenue of over Rs 8,700
Crore & a market capitalization of over Rs 80,000 Crore. Built on a legacy of over 135 years of
quality and experience, Dabur is the most trusted name in India today and the world's largest
Ayurvedic and Natural Health Care Company. In 1884, Dabur India Ltd was established by S. K.
Burman and Uttar Pradesh, with its headquarters in Ghaziabad. Ayurvedic medicine and natural
consumer goods are produced here. It is one of India's largest quick-moving consumer goods
businesses. Today, Dabur operates in main categories of consumer goods such as hair care, oral
care, dental care, skincare, home care, and foods. The Ayurvedic company has an extensive
distribution network, serving 6.7 million high-penetration retail outlets in urban and rural
markets.

About Godrej Consumer Products Ltd.

Godrej Consumer Products Limited (GCPL), based in Mumbai, India, is an Indian consumer
goods company. Soap, hair coloring, toiletries and liquid detergents are included in the GCPL
products. 'Cinthol,'' Godrej Fair Glow,'' Godrej No.1' and 'Godrej Shikakai' in soaps,' Godrej
Powder Hair Dye,'' Refresh,'' ColourSoft' in hair dyes and 'Ezee' liquid detergent are its
products. In India, GCPL operates multiple production facilities spread over seven locations and
is grouped into four operating clusters in Malanpur (Madhya Pradesh), Guwahati (Assam),
Baddi-Thana (Himachal Pradesh), Baddi-Katha (Himachal Pradesh), Pondicherry, Chennai and
Sikkim.
